The Great Somali Census Caper: Pinning Down a Number
There's no single, official count of Somalis in Atlanta. It's like trying to count all the stars in the Georgia sky on a clear night – there's a bunch, but an exact number? Fugetaboutit!
Here's what we do know: Atlanta has a thriving Somali community. We're talking delicious halal restaurants, bustling markets, and beautiful mosques. It's a cultural smorgasbord! Estimates range from around 5,000 to 7,000 Somalis according to some community leaders.
But that number might be a little shy. Why? Because Atlanta's a magnet for folks from all over, and some Somalis might not be counted in traditional surveys. Where in Atlanta Do You Find Somalis?
If you're looking to experience Somali culture firsthand, head to DeKalb and Gwinnett Counties. These areas are home to a large concentration of Somali families. Here, you can find everything from Somali businesses to community centers – it's a mini-Somalia right here in the ATL!
